【问题标题】:Run AWS Lambda function to collate certs cross account运行 AWS Lambda 函数以跨账户整理证书
【发布时间】:2020-08-22 08:08:02
【问题描述】:

我正在使用this lambda 函数来通知即将到期的 acmes 证书。对于我正在执行它的帐户,它工作正常,假设帐户 A。

我希望这个功能可以跨账户和

  • 遍历我的所有 AWS 账户,检测过期证书
  • 为其他帐户的证书发布 SNS。

谁能指导我: 如何让账户“A”中的这个 lambda 函数在我的所有 AWS 账户中查找证书并进行 SNS 发布?

【问题讨论】:

    标签: python-3.x amazon-web-services aws-lambda boto3 amazon-iam


    【解决方案1】:

    您需要在其他每个账户中创建一个角色,该角色有权查看 ACM 并授予对运行 Lambda 的账户的访问权限。

    然后更新 Lambda 角色以允许它代入其他账户的角色。

    您需要有一个帐户列表才能知道要担任哪个帐户的角色。

    其他链接

    【讨论】:

    猜你喜欢
    • 2016-11-02
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 2023-02-02
    • 2020-01-12
    • 1970-01-01
    • 2022-12-12
    • 2020-06-18
    相关资源
    最近更新 更多